At present,the universal form of economic development in the area of Pearl River Delta city agglomeration is to gather and diffuse along with the traffic arteries in the process of regional economic development. Nevertheless, the traffic function of connect-roads for the long-distance traffic between cities has been difference from the one of highway and streets except freeway, these roads have not the criterion in the process of planning, designing and rebuilding. So that, it is imperative to put forward the traffic space design according to the situation of Pearl River Delta city agglomeration and traffic function needs.This paper researches on the design and use of the connect-roads in Pearl River Delta urban agglomerations to find out the existing problems, and propose practical traffic space design of the urban agglomerations connect-roads for the planning and designing in the future.Firstly, based on the analysis of the connect-roads datum, the author suggested reasonable widths of each essential component of the cross-sections according to the traffic function and criterions of road, brought up standard cross-sections and their characters and adaptabilities of city agglomeration connect-roads.Secondly, the author proposed some general and especial intersections which apply to various city agglomeration connect-roads based on analyzing their traffic characteristics.Finally, this paper brought forward the minimum distance of exit and entrance according to vehicle operation characteristics. Additionally, the paper suggested the rational distance data by adopting the quantitative and qualitative methods to make sure the distance of ordinary exit and entrance of high-speed and long-distance city agglomeration connect-roads.
